Transaction 05bec32417cb294737f26ca476dd86b84855659dfad412a1e6c76a8213d3b564
1 Input
1 Output
-
05bec32417cb294737f26ca476dd86b84855659dfad412a1e6c76a8213d3b564:0
- value
- 26340927
- script pubkey
- OP_0 OP_PUSHBYTES_20 45151f13cf358b04a09b16674c3a219b1cb014c1
- address
- bc1qg5237y70xk9sfgymzen5cw3pnvwtq9xpse44eg